Abstract
The invention discloses an aerosol generating device convenient to clean, which comprises a shell, wherein the top end of the shell is provided with an insertion hole for inserting a consumable containing a smokeable material, a heater for heating the smokeable material in the consumable is arranged in the shell, the aerosol generating device also comprises a detachable stop piece for stopping the consumable inserted in the heater, the bottom of the shell is provided with a stop piece insertion hole, and when the stop piece plugs the stop piece insertion hole, the stop piece is flush with the outer surface of the bottom of the shell; the invention also discloses an aerosol-generating system comprising the aerosol-generating device and a consumable. The invention adopts the stop piece which can be conveniently detached, and solves the problem of inconvenient cleaning in the use process.

Technical Field
The invention relates to the technical field of novel tobacco, in particular to an aerosol generating device and an aerosol generating system which are convenient to clean.
Background
Smoking articles (e.g., cigarettes, cigars, etc.) burn tobacco during use to produce tobacco smoke. Attempts have been made to replace these tobacco-burning products by making products that release compounds without burning.
An example of such a product is a heating device that generates an aerosol by heating rather than burning smokable material. For example, the material may be tobacco or other non-tobacco products, which may or may not include nicotine. There are aerosol-generating devices, for example so-called electrically heated non-burning smoking articles, which together with a rod-like consumable inserted therein can form an aerosol-generating system. The known electric heating non-combustion smoking set has the problems of inconvenient cleaning, too large or too small suction resistance and the like in the use process, and the consumption quality is influenced.

As shown in figures 1 to 4, an aerosol-generating device for heating smokable material to cause the smokable material to generate an aerosol. The consumable 200 containing smokable material is typically in the form of a tobacco rod comprising smokable material 201 at the front end, an intermediate cooling structure 202 and a filter structure 203 at the mouth end. The aerosol-generating device 100 and the smokable material consumable 200 inserted therein constitute an aerosol-generating system.
The aerosol generating device 100 comprises a housing 1, the housing 1 is formed by combining a front housing, a rear housing, an upper top cover 11 and a lower bottom cover 12, a sliding cover 13 and an insertion opening 14 are arranged on the top cover 11, the sliding cover 13 can be moved to expose the insertion opening 14 when in use, so that the consumable 200 can be inserted, and the sliding cover 13 can cover the insertion opening 14 when not in use to prevent foreign matters from entering.
Below the insertion opening 14, the holder 2, the holder 3, the heater 4, the heat insulating pipe 5, the sleeve 6, and the stopper 7 are provided in this order.
In use, the consumable 200 can be removably inserted into the aerosol-generating device 100 through the clip portion 2 and clipped by the clip portion 2. The clamping part 2 is not in thermal contact with the fixed base 3 and the heater 4, so that the clamping part 2 is prevented from being scalded in the using process and then heating the clamped part of the consumable 200. Generally, when the consumable 200 is fully inserted into the aerosol-generating device 100, the holder 2 holds non-smokable material portions, such as the cooling structure 202 and/or the filtering structure 203, and since the aerosol smoke generated by the smokable material 201 portions has a high temperature and needs to be cooled by the cooling structure 202 and/or the filtering structure 203, if these portions are also heated by the heated holder 2, the smoke entering the mouth of the consumer will have a too high temperature, which may affect the experience and effectiveness of smoking.
A heater 4 is provided within the housing 1 for heating the smokable material 201 within the consumable 200, the heater 4 may take the form of electrical resistance heating, electromagnetic induction heating, infrared heating or the like.
The outer side of the heater 4 is sleeved with a heat insulation pipe 5 to prevent heat energy from leaking, and the heat insulation pipe 5 can be made of high-temperature resistant heat insulation materials or can be a vacuum heat insulation pipe. For the infrared heating heater 4, an infrared reflecting surface may be further provided inside the heat insulating pipe 5. The outer side of the heat insulation pipe 5 is further sleeved with a sleeve 6, and the bottom of the sleeve 6 is provided with mounting positions corresponding to the heater 4 and the heat insulation pipe 5, so that the heater 4, the heat insulation pipe 5 and the sleeve 6 can be sequentially arranged from inside to outside at concentric intervals.
The heater 4, the heat insulation pipe 5 and the top end of the sleeve 6 are inserted on the fixed seat 3 from inside to outside in sequence and are concentrically arranged at intervals. The fixing base 3 needs to be able to withstand the high temperature generated by the heater 4, and may be made of high temperature resistant materials such as PEEK. Sealing structures are arranged between the fixed seat 3 and the heater 4, the heat insulation pipe 5 and the sleeve 6 to prevent heat and smoke from leaking outwards along the radial direction of the sleeve 6, so that a second space is formed. Thus, in use, air may enter the heated space inside the heater 4 from the bottom of the sleeve 6, mix with the heated smokable material to form a smoke containing aerosol, and be inhaled by a consumer from the mouth end of the consumable.
The housing 1 of the aerosol-generating device 100 is provided with a first space within which a power supply 8 and a circuit board 9 are provided, the power supply 8 being for supplying electrical power to the heater 4, the circuit board 9 being operable to control the power supply 8 to supply electrical power to the heater 4 as required. The first space is sealed at the top cover 11, so that the smoke overflowing from the upper part of the heater 4 in the using process is prevented from flowing into the first space to pollute the power supply 8 and the circuit board 9, and potential safety hazards such as short circuit are caused. ,
as shown in fig. 4-9, the stopper 7 is removably arranged at the bottom of the aerosol-generating device 100 and extends into the bottom of the heater 4, and the stopper 7 may abut against the consumable 200 when the consumable 200 is inserted into the heater 4 during use, thereby positioning the consumable 200. During cleaning the stop 7 can be removed and a cleaning tool can be inserted from the bottom of the heater 4 and cleaned.
The stopper 7 includes a stopper head 71 and a stopper bottom 72, and the stopper head 71 and the stopper bottom 72 may be integrally formed or may be formed by combining two or more members. The bottom cover 12 has a stopper insertion port 121 thereon. In use, the stopper 7 is inserted into the aerosol-generating device 100 through the stopper insertion opening 121, with the stopper bottom 72 closing off the stopper insertion opening 121, the stopper bottom 72 being flush with the outer surface of the bottom cover 12, thereby ensuring the smoothness of the product appearance. During cleaning, the stopper pull handle 73 on the stopper base 72 can be pulled, the stopper pull handle 73 can rotate about the 7-axis of rotation 74 by about 90 °, and the consumer can pull the stopper pull handle 73 to remove the stopper 7 from the aerosol-generating device 100.
The stopper bottom 72 is provided with air inlet holes 721 through which outside air can flow smoothly into the interior of the aerosol-generating device 100 in the first gas flow direction (arrow (r)). Then, the external air is gradually gathered toward the center in the first gas flow direction (arrow @) under the guidance of the second air passage groove 911 at the lower half portion of the stopper head portion 91, and then passes through the intermediate transition through hole 912 between the lower and upper half portions of the stopper head portion 91 to enter the first air passage groove 913. Since the stopper head 91 supports the consumable 200 by projecting a plurality of circumferentially uniformly distributed support arms 914 (two in the figure), the outside air can rapidly spread all around from the gap between the support arms 914 after entering the upper half of the stopper head 91 through the intermediate transition through-hole 912, thereby entering the consumable 200 uniformly and mixing well with the smokable material under heating, improving smoke quality and consumer sensory enjoyment. In addition, the main factor determining the suction resistance of the aerosol generating device only lies in the size and the shape of the middle transition through hole 912, so that the suction resistance can be adjusted by a designer conveniently, the problem that the suction resistance of a product is too large or too small is avoided, and the consumption quality is improved.
